No-nonsense defender is desperate to remain with the champions.
Manchester City centre-back Joleon Lescott says that is determined to win his starting place back with the Premier League title holders, reports the Daily Telegraph.
The 30-year-old has endured a tough season at the Ethiad stadium, losing his place at the heart of the City back four to new signing Matija Nastasic, who arrived at Eastlands from Serie A outfit Fiorentina for 15 million euros last summer.
And, the England international has found it hard to get back into the team due to the Serbian’s impressive displays for his new team this campaign, so much so that Lescott has appeared in only 21 of City’s 32 top-flight matches so far this season, compared to featuring in 33 Premier League contests as City won the title last year.
As a result, Lescott has grown concerned that he may lose his place in the national setup if he is not playing regularly next campaign, a season that will hopefully culminate in England taking part in the World Cup finals in Brazil.
